Detached homes in Midland took a median of 36 days to sell over the last 90 days, with the quickest quarter selling within 18 days and the slowest quarter taking more than 66, across 46 recorded sales.
That clock counts only the listing each home finally sold on. Measured from the first time these properties came to market, including any earlier listings that were withdrawn and re-entered, the median is 59 days.
The median sale price was $573,950.
Homes sold for about 3.5% below asking on average, so there was room to negotiate.
About 2% of sales closed above the list price.
Around 30% of sellers reduced their price before finding a buyer.
Based on 46 recorded sales in the last 90 days — a small sample, so treat these figures as indicative. Aggregate statistics only; individual sale prices are not shown.
